About The Time of a Young Man About to Kill (2015) — A Short Film of Blood and Time in Albania's Mountains

Set against the rugged, mist-shrouded peaks of Northern Albania, *The Time of a Young Man About to Kill* (2015) immerses viewers in a gripping drama of vengeance and moral reckoning. Directed by Neritan Zinxhiria, this short film follows a grieving son who kidnaps his father's murderer's child, intending to raise him in isolation for 16 years—until the young victim reaches the age of accountability under the Kanun, Albania's ancient code of blood feuds. The story unfolds with raw intensity, blending psychological tension with the stark beauty of its mountain setting, as the protagonist navigates the fine line between justice and cruelty. Bartosz Bielenia leads the cast with a haunting portrayal, while Suzana Prifti and Karafil Shena deliver performances that underscore the film's themes of legacy, time, and the cyclical nature of violence.
